TRAVEL FLASH - August 17, 2026

Breaking: FAA orders broad 737 MAX inspections after discovery of structural cracks, sharpening global focus on fleet safety and reliability[12]

TOP 3 STORIES:
1. FAA mandates inspections for hundreds of Boeing 737 MAX aircraft after cracks are found on older jets, intensifying regulatory scrutiny and raising near-term maintenance burdens for carriers operating the type[12]. Network planners should prepare for short-notice schedule changes and potential capacity constraints on MAX-heavy routes, while corporate buyers and frequent travelers are advised to monitor airline-specific safety communications and reaccommodation policies[12].

2. Global airline market data for June show a 1.7% year-on-year decline in passenger demand, even as air cargo grows 8.5% and major U.S. carriers post strong Q2 earnings, highlighting a divergence between leisure volume and yield-focused capacity management[5]. Revenue managers and travel buyers should expect more targeted fare increases on resilient business and long-haul segments, with tighter inventory on profitable routes and continued incentive deals around off-peak and secondary markets[5].

3. Boeing secures FAA type certification for the 737-7 and Qantas confirms a mixed Airbus A350/Boeing 787 long-haul order, rebalancing single-aisle competition and signaling aggressive fleet renewal in the transpacific and ultra-long-haul space[5]. For travel professionals, this points to improved product consistency and fuel efficiency on future Qantas long-haul services, while GDS and TMC teams should track upcoming equipment changes that could affect cabin layouts, premium seat counts, and sustainability reporting for corporate clients[5].

Flash Insight: The combination of stricter 737 MAX safety oversight and ongoing fleet modernization underscores a structural shift toward fewer aircraft types with higher reliability, forcing airlines to balance risk, capex, and brand perception more carefully[5][12]. Softening passenger demand alongside robust cargo and solid earnings at leading U.S. carriers suggests a pivot from pure volume growth to disciplined capacity and yield management, which will translate into more dynamic pricing and sharper segmentation of leisure versus corporate offers[5]. Over the next 12–18 months, travel buyers and intermediaries should expect increased emphasis on safety transparency, aircraft-type disclosure, and sustainability metrics as airlines use fleet strategy and operational resilience as key differentiators in a more cautious demand environment[3][5][12].
